Position Summary

The Executive Director of Capital Projects provides executive-level leadership and oversight for the planning, coordination, and delivery of Tulsa Public Schools’ capital improvement projects. This role is responsible for managing the execution of major construction, renovation, and facility improvement projects across the district. Working in close partnership with Facilities, Finance, and district leadership, this position ensures projects are delivered on time, within budget, and in alignment with district priorities. The Executive Director supports long-range capital planning efforts through project input and feasibility analysis, while maintaining primary responsibility for project execution, contractor management, and capital project performance. This role requires strong financial and contractual management skills, the ability to coordinate across multiple stakeholders, and the capacity to represent the district with professionalism and credibility.

Education

  •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university in architecture, engineering, construction management, or a related field required
  • Master’s degree or advanced certification in a related field preferred

Experience

  • Minimum of seven (7) years of professional experience in construction management, architecture, engineering, or capital projects administration
  • Minimum of three (3) years of experience in a supervisory or leadership capacity
  • Experience managing construction budgets, contracts, and project timelines
  • Experience in a public agency, school district, or similarly complex organization preferred

Licenses And Certifications

  • Valid Oklahoma driver’s license required
  • Professional licensure (e.g., Architect or Professional Engineer) preferred

Knowledge, Skills, And Abilities

  • Strong knowledge of construction management principles, project delivery methods, and capital project lifecycle
  • Knowledge of budgeting, cost estimating, contract administration, and schedule management
  • Familiarity with public procurement processes and regulatory requirements
  • Working knowledge of building codes, life-safety standards, and construction compliance requirements
  • Ability to manage multiple complex projects simultaneously while maintaining quality and timelines
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with the ability to assess risks and implement solutions
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ills, including the ability to present to leadership and stakeholders
  • Ability to build and maintain effective working relationships across departments and with external partners
  • Strong organizational and time management skills
